SUBJECT: Information request regarding clinical shell tables for study C4591001
Dear Ms. Harkins :
Reference is made to your original BLA STN 125742/0 for COVID -19 mRNA Vaccine
(COMIRNATY), for active immunization to prevent COVID -19 caused by SARS -CoV-2 in
individuals ≥16 years of age. Our review of your application is ongoing and we have the
following information requests at this time. Information Requests, regarding Study C4591001:
1. Please provide the number and percentage of clinical COVID cases that meet the case
definition but not confirmed by PCR for any reason (e.g., not done, sample lost, out of window), by study arm.
2. Please provide the cumulative incidence rates for the vaccine group as compared to the
placebo group at 2, 4, and 6 months post dose 1 to complement the cumulative
incidence curve submitted (Figure 2, pg 104, from c4591001- interim -mth6 -report -
body.pdf) .

3. It appears that you have included Subject 10941002 in the efficacy a nalysis for first
COVID -19 occurrence from 7 days after dose 2 over blinded placebo- controlled follow-
up period in subjects without evidence of infection prior to 7 days after dose 2 (e.g. Table
16 of C4591001- interim -6-Month Report Body). However, this subject reported “covid -19
antibody test positive” in medical history, and the baseline COVID status was categorized as positive, as indicated in the ADSL data set. Please confirm whether this subject is included in the VE analysis in subjects without evidence of infection prior to 7
days after dose 2, and if yes, please provide a rationale for including this subject in the
analysis.
4. It appears that Subject 10031167 was considered to have a confirmed COVID case, with an onset date 11/02/2020, in your efficacy analysis. We note that this subject reported three episodes of symptoms (from 10/08/2020 to 10/16/2020, 11/2/2020 to 12/11/2020,
and 12/17/2020 to 01/16/2021, respectively), and the PCR tests were negative for the
first two episodes and positive for the third episode. In Appendix 3 of the SAP, it is stated
that “if new symptoms are reported within 4 days after resolution of all previous symptoms, they will be considered as part of a single illness.” Since the second and third episodes were more than 4 days apart, it appears that they should be counted as
separate episodes. Hence, the subject would be considered to have a COVID case with
an onset on 12/17/2020. Since this subject was unblinded on 12/16/2020, this case occurred after unblinding and should not be included in the efficacy analysis during the blinded placebo- controlled follow up period. Please comment.

In the efficacy analyses, subjects at risk were determined (in part) by the “PDRMUPFL=’N’” condition, which would exclude all subjects who had reported COVID symptoms but had missing or unknown PCR results at any time. It may be reasonable to exclude subjects who had reported COVID symptoms but had missing/unknown PCR results prior to 7 days after dose 2 for the efficacy analyses in subjects without evidence of infection, as this would define a more specific group of subjects without evidence of
infection. However, based on your analyses, subjects who reported symptoms and had
missing/unknown PCR results after 7 days post dose 2 were also excluded from the efficacy analyses, while these subjects were in fact at risk for the efficacy endpoint starting from 7 days post dose 2. For example, Subject 10011087 was excluded since he/she reported symptoms on 01/09/2021 without any associated PCR result, which was
~144 days post dose 2.
a. Please explain why these subjects were not considered at risk for the respective
efficacy endpoints, and comment on the impact of the exclusion on the VE
results.
b. In Section 6.1.3.1.2 of the SAP, it is stated that “with MAR assumption, a missing
efficacy endpoint (laboratory -confirmed COVID -19 results) may be imputed
based on predicted probability using the fully conditional specification method.”
Please clarify whether this sensitivity analysis was conducted and the location of the sensitivity analyses if they were submitted. If not, please perform such a
sensitivity analysis for subjects who reported COVID symptoms but had
missing/unknown PCR results.
